About K. D. Thornbury
K. D. Thornbury is a scholar working on Sensory Systems, Urology and Cellular and Molecular Neuroscience, having authored 134 papers that have together received 3.3k indexed citations. Recurring topics across this work include Ion channel regulation and function (67 papers), Ion Channels and Receptors (39 papers) and Urinary Bladder and Prostate Research (26 papers). The work is most often cited by research in Sensory Systems (673 citations), Urology (641 citations) and Gastroenterology (393 citations). K. D. Thornbury has collaborated with scholars based in Ireland, United Kingdom and United States. Frequent co-authors include Mark A. Hollywood, Noel G. McHale, Gerard P. Sergeant, N. G. McHale, Karen D. McCloskey, Sean M. Ward, Kenton M. Sanders, Hugh H. Dalziel, Andrew Chaytor and Tudor M. Griffith. Their work appears in journals such as Proceedings of the National Academy of Sciences, Journal of Biological Chemistry and The Journal of Physiology.
